OBSERVATION CHECKLIST IN TEACHING ENGLISH
Grade I-VI
2C21A
Name of Teacher: __________ ___________________ Date: _____________
Subject Observed: _____________________________Time: ____________
CRITERIA 4 3 2 1
I. OBJECTIVES
1. Objectives
1.1 Listening
1.2 Reading
1.3 Speaking
1.4 Writing
2. Objectives taken from the BEC - PELC
Sub Total
II. SUBJECT MATTER
1. Subject matter congruent with the objectives
2. Story, materials and references were written as part of the
plan
Sub total
III. LEARNING ACTIVITIES
A. Discovery the Magic of Reading
Pre Reading
Developing Previewing Vocabulary
1. Techniques used in the unlocking of the difficulties
effectively done
Building Background Knowledge
2. Motivation activated prior experiences of pupils
3. The teacher set the purpose for reading
4. Motivation parallel to the motive question
5. Standards set for listening before the
story/poem/dialogue reading/telling/shared reading
B. Constructing Meaning (Active Reading)
6. Attention of the pupils held during the
story/poem/dialogue reading/telling/shared reading
7. The teacher read the story (Grade I-II)
First Reading – open and read the story showing pictures
Second Reading – give pupils a chance to interact with the
text depending of techniques use in reading e.g. DRA,
DRATA (interacting with text)
8. Children showed signs of using their HOT skills through
predicting, inferring and interacting with the text,
classmates and teacher
a. The teacher used varied strategies suited to learners need
1. Motive question first asked during the discussion
2. Varied activities the maximized pupil participation were
employed
3. Activities were focused on developing the multiple
intelligences of pupils
4. Standards/procedure were established among pupils which
were observable during the group activities
5. Motive question first asked during the discussion
6. Questions correctly framed and within the level of the
pupils
7. Question shall develop HOT skills of pupils
8. Appropriate instructional materials were used to meet the
needs of pupils
Observer
Signature Over Printed Name
Post Reading
Engagement 1 – Group Activities
9. The teacher provided multiple intelligences activities
10.Teacher roamed around while children were
busy doing the activity
11.Teacher set standard and procedure among her
pupils
Engagement 2
12.Question were arranged according to
Dimensions or(gradual psychological unfolding
13.Maximum participation among pupils were
observed
14.Engagement 1 was embedded or part of the
Engagement II
Sub Total
C. Developing English Language Competencies (DELC)
1. Stories/text/passage/poem/paragraphs and other
2. Reading material used in the Reading Phase was utilized
as a spring board to present the lesson
3. Motivation was interesting and caught the attention of
pupils
4. Teaching strategies were congruent with the objectives
5. Adequate and appropriate instructional material were
utilized
6. Varied techniques/strategies/approaches were utilized
7. Maximum participation was observed
a. Mastery of the structures was evident
b. evaluation was congruent with the objectives
Sub Total
D. Deciphering and Decoding: Strategies and Skills
a. Words were presented in varied and meaningful situations
b. Word attack techniques/strategies were effectively utilized
c. Appropriate and sufficient visual aids were used
d. Sufficient exercises were presented to ensure word
recognition
e. Hierarchically sequence exercises were used
f. Instructional materials were effectively utilized
g. Proper decoding of the following was observed:
1. words
2. phrases
3. sentences
Sub Total
IV. EVALUATION
1. Evaluation items ( test items) were congruent with
the objective/s
Sub Total
V. ASSIGNMENT
1. Assignment for mastery/ preparation for the next
lesson
Sub Total
GRAND TOTAL
Legend:
4 – Outstanding
3 – Very Satisfactory
2 – Satisfactory
1 – Needs Improvement
